What does nmms mean in english

What does no mames mean? No mames is crude Spanish slang used to express disbelief (both positive and negative) or excitement. Used especially among Mexican Spanish speakers, the exclamation corresponds to “No way!”, “You’re kidding me!”, or “Stop messing with me!”.

Is No Manches a bad word?

No manches Is the soft version of the vulgar version: no mames that Is used in the same cases, but in extreme situations because no mames Is rude, explicit, vulgar an offensive.

Why do Spanish guys say Mami?

“Mami” is Spanish for mom, mommy, and mama.. but it could also be used as a term of endearment/sexual interest used towards a female of interest. Kinda like the equivalent in English “little mama” basically.. and it’s practically the same thing as when a woman refers to a man as “Daddy”.

What makes someone a Takuache?

Tlacuache or takuache is the Spanish word for possum. However, “takuache” is also a slang term for a group of people that love three things — dropped trucks, burnouts, and the truck meet life style.

Is no Mames offensive?

“No Mames” is a VERY rude and disgusting phrase to use in front of a woman, or strangers. “No Manches” Is a lot more decent, but it still is not proper Spanish. “No Manches” liberally means, “don’t screw (joke or play) around” or “quit screwing around.” “Te banas” literally means bathe yourself.

What does Orale vato mean?

Basically it means “Truth!” or “Preach on!” As a greeting, the word is used by Cheech Marin in his 1987 film Born in East L.A. in the phrase “Órale vato, ¡wassápenin!”, meaning “All right, man!

What does ese mean in slang?

What does ese mean? Ese, amigo, hombre. Or, in English slang, dude, bro, homey. Ese is a Mexican-Spanish slang term of address for a fellow man.

Is Hijole a bad word?

I hear Latinos, particularly Mexicans, exclaim “¡hijo le!” quite frequently. My Mexican husband says it’s sort of like “son of a . . .!” to express surprise, as if it’s a shortened form of a phrase that could be vulgar.

What does mija mean in Spanish?

Literally meaning “my daughter,” mija is used as a familiar and affectionate address to women, like “dear” or “honey,” in Spanish.

What is the meaning of Mamacita in Spanish?

The literal translation of mamacita is “little mother” but the figurative and more accurate translation is “hot momma.” The moniker is never really used to describe an actual mother, a genuine mamá or mamita.

Is Paisano a slur?

Short for paisano (“countryman”), this is actually a widespread slur, but has a distinct definition in our prison system, referring to inmates born in Mexico to differentiate them from the Mexican cons born in the United States (“raza”).
